    After Soggy June, Get Ready For ‘Corn Sweat’ Summer As Heat Wave Approaches

    Chicago and Illinois are experiencing increased humidity due to 'corn sweat,' a phenomenon where cornfields release 4,000 gallons of water daily through evapotranspiration. This process raises heat indices near 100°F as temperatures rise into the 90s, with Illinois corn crops releasing 35 billion gallons of water daily. Heavy June rainfall in northern Illinois, combined with a heat wave, has intensified the effect early this summer.

    Before air conditioning was common, people used blocks of ice and fire hydrants to stay cool

    Before air conditioning became common in mid-20th century US homes, people used ice blocks, fans, and cold drinks to stay cool. Historical records show iceboxes, mechanical cooling techniques, and frozen treats like ice cream were key methods. Recent heat waves highlight the growing necessity of air conditioning as temperatures set new records.
